Match Events


1' START OF FIRST HALF

3' Corner kick sets up to Brillant, but his header is blocked out for another corner.

7' Loose clearance is latched onto by Rodriguez, but his shot is over the crossbar.

12' Great run by Jara to find the ball over the top, but his shot is saved by Guzan. Rebound falls for Arriola, but his attempt is blocked, another chance for Jara, but it's off-target.

20' Free kick by Martinez is no where close to the goal, ends up in the stands.

24' Right footer from Villalba is blocked and cleared.

33' Looped over the top for Arriola in the box, he pulls his shot well wide.

38' At the corner of the D, Rooney puts in a low shot, but it's just wide.

40' To the endline for Acosta, he cuts it back to a wide open Moreno, his shot is straight to Guzan.

41' Shot from distance by Villalba has pace, but he puts it wide of the far post.

44' Chance for Rodriguez near the penalty spot is blocked, Acosta's follow-up is also blocked for a corner.

45'+1 GOAL!!! A controversial corner kick is awarded, and on the subsequent corner kick the ball finds Rooney, he knocks it down and Arriola runs through it to put the hosts up! DC United 1-0 Atlanta United FC

45' +2 HALF TIME DC United 1-0 Atlanta United FC


46' START OF SECOND HALF

48' Shot from outside the penalty area by Canouse is just off the corner of the goal.

53' Yellow card issued to Ambrose for taking out Mora on the wing.

55' Attempt by Rodriguez is saved comfortably by Guzan.

58' GOAL!!! The rain really takes a toll on Atlanta as Acosta sends in his shot from the top of the area, it takes an awkward skip that puts Guzan off, and ends up in the net! DC United 2-0 Atlanta United FC

59' G. Martinez and Gressel replace Villalba and Ambrose

60' Second shot for Martinez tonight, he can't put this one on frame, either.

62' Great opportunity back across the box for Rooney, but he mishits it badly.

67' Rodriguez makes way for Segura

70' Long range blast from Remedi is pushed aside by Hamid.

72' Why not, Nagbe gives it a go from distance, but it's nowhere close to finding the frame of the net.

77' Larentowicz is on for Barco

78' More long range shots from Atlanta, Gressel puts his over the bar.

83' Second booking of the night is to Larentowicz for fouling Arriola.

88' Acosta receives his ovation and Durkin enters.

89' Strong shot by Segura, but this time Guzan is able to make the save.

90' +2 Shot from Pity is on frame, but stopped by Hamid.

90' +4 FULL TIME DC United 2-0 Atlanta United FC
